just FYI to everyone on this thread if you just go to a corporate store they will take care of you in one way or another. At the few stores in jersey I went to they all had the general same principles: a) loaner samsung device ONLY if you wanted to wait for Note 7 replacement. It's not really a "loaner" as you would be signing a new agreement on that loaner device. If you wanted to exchange into an iPhone or non samsung device, no loaners at all. b) You could preorder iphone7 and return Note7, however you would need an old temporary device to activate on account unless you wanted to be without a device for that period of time. c) Just keep the existing Note7 until new ones were out. At both stores I went to i was told the new ones were expected No later than 9/30, but that they were not given any clear direction from Samsung on what to do, so that is why their messages to customers have been so vague. . . All of these options were done with no fees, no restocking fees or anything. This also includes returning all accessories you got from verizon as well with no restocking fees and waiving the return period time. I returned the Note7, and my various accessories (cables, chargers, case, screen protector) and then replaced with an iphone6s for now. They refunded the accessories no problem. . If you do visit a store I encourage to bring all the receipts, because this makes their life and yours much easier and makes for a speedier visit to the store. About 1/2 hour later or so I walked out with a new, working device ready to go.
